LAHORE: Five incidents of rape cases have been reported in the Punjab capital during the last 24 hours.
According to the police, all cases of rape have been recorded at different police stations across the city. A mother of four children was allegedly raped in the Bhagatpura area. In another incident, a man from the Johar Town area named Maqbool allegedly raped his 16-year-old stepdaughter. The case was lodged by his wife who is also the mother of the victim.
In another horrific incident, a 10-year-old was raped by an unidentified man in Manawan. In the Lari Ada area, a 17-year-old teenager was raped after being promised a job by an unidentified man. Moreover, the Nawankot police arrested a 15-year-old boy for trying to rape a seven-year-old girl on Church Road.

Pakistan is the sixth most dangerous country in the world for women, according to the Thomson Reuters Foundation. The Karachi-based organisation War Against Rape estimated that less than 3 percent of rape cases lead to convictions.
